Ayşe Mudun is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Ayşe Mudun has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 507 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Surgery, 9 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 7 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Ayşe Mudun’s work include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(5 papers),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(5 papers) and Breast Lesions and Carcinomas (3 papers). Ayşe Mudun is often cited by papers focused on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(5 papers),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(5 papers) and Breast Lesions and Carcinomas (3 papers). Ayşe Mudun coll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, United States and China. Ayşe Mudun's co-authors include Yasemin Şanlı, Cüneyt Türkmen, Seher Ünal, Serkan Kuyumcu, Zeynep Gözde Özkan, İşık Adalet, Faruk Taş, Sevda Özel, Ekrem Yavuz and Sıdıka Kurul and has published in prestigious journals such as The American Journal of Surgery, Thyroid and Journal of Surgical Oncology.
